Optometrists

Palo Alto, CA, United States

73 places in Palo Alto, ordered by rating:

5.0
10 reviews
Telephone:
+1 650-322-6656
Address:
109 S California Ave Ste 101D
5.0
1 review
Telephone:
+1 650-322-4393
Address:
706 Webster St
5.0
2 reviews
Telephone:
+1 650-853-2974
Address:
795 El Camino Real
4.1
20 reviews
Telephone:
+1 650-321-3382
Address:
2750 Middlefield Rd
3.9
13 reviews
Telephone:
+1 650-329-1600
Address:
725 University Ave
···
Telephone:
+1 650-498-2565
Address:
725 Welch Road
···
Telephone:
+1 650-323-4051
Address:
84 Town & Country Vlg
···
Telephone:
+1 650-321-2015
Address:
540 University Avenue
···
Telephone:
+1 650-498-7020
Address:
900 Blake Wilbur Drive
···
Telephone:
+1 650-723-6995
Address:
Palo Alto, CA 94301
···
Telephone:
+1 650-723-6995
Address:
900 Blake Wilbur Drive
···
Telephone:
+1 650-853-2974
Address:
795 El Camino Real
···
Telephone:
+1 650-853-2974
Address:
795 El Camino Real
···
Telephone:
+1 650-723-6995
Address:
900 Blake Wilbur Drive
···
Telephone:
+1 650-723-6995
Address:
900 Blake Wilbur Drive
···
Telephone:
+1 650-322-6656
Address:
616 Ramona St Ste 2
···
Telephone:
+1 650-723-6995
Address:
900 Blake Wilbur Dr
···
Telephone:
+1 650-324-0056
Address:
900 Welch Road
···
Telephone:
+1 650-853-2974
Address:
795 El Camino Real
···
Telephone:
+1 650-725-9993
Address:
900 Blake Wilbur Drive